我对D3.js很新。我正在尝试使用 D3.js 和 angularjs 构建折线图。我收到了上述错误。
我通过休息服务的控制台中的数据看起来像
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<a data-request-url="https://jsonplaceholder.typicode.com/posts/1">abc</a>
下面是我的Controller类代码,其中我附加了图表。
[{"id":1,"time":"Jun 19, 2017 13:17:21","ltp":9620.5,"time1":20170619},
{"id":2,"time":"Jun 20, 2017 13:27:21","ltp":9617.7,"time1":20170620},
{"id":3,"time":"Jun 21, 2017 13:36:51","ltp":9615.3,"time1":20170621}]
请指导我建立图表。
提前致谢。
答案 0 :(得分:1)
我找到了解决方案。
在上面的代码中, $ scope.chartConfig 的实现是错误的。要实施的正确方法是
$scope.chartConfig={
data:[{}]
};
$scope.chartConfig.data.push(responseNifty);
取代
{{1}}